Yancoal's June quarter saw a 20% jump in attributable saleable coal production to 10.8 million tonnes, supported by rising realised coal prices and operational improvements. The company advances its strategic growth with the pending acquisition of an 80% stake in the Kestrel Coal Mine, while planning to close Ashton mine by early 2028.

Lotus Resources has completed key acid plant repairs at its Kayelekera uranium mine, targeting production restart in early August 2026 and steady-state output by late year. The company also formalised a binding commitment with Mercuria for a US$30 million prepayment facility amid ongoing funding negotiations.
